// DocSweep linter threshold.
// If DocSweep starts flagging half the wiki at 3am, it's almost
// certainly because someone bumped this constant without regenerating
// the style ruleset. Don't panic and don't revert blindly — regenerate
// the rules first, then re-run the sweep. If it's still noisy, page
// the docs-tools rotation. This value was last validated against the
// pipeline run noted below.

session token of taduf-tahog = htk4_91a1

Hey Mirla — handing off GraphGlance releases while I'm out. The dependency visualizer ships Thursdays; CI builds the DAG snapshot automatically, so you mostly just tag and push. One quirk: the edge-renderer cache needs a manual bust after tagging. For the weekly sync, mention v2.4 is on track. The release artifact must be signed with the key below.

release key, hadug-kawef: bky13_mPGeFZeR1GZ1G

**Ticket: Config drift via bulk edits in Hoverlane admin table**

Bulk edit in the Hoverlane admin grid bypasses the config validation hook. Three tenants now have mismatched throttle settings versus the source-of-truth repo. Drift first seen after the Marldeck migration. Bulk path needs the same review gate as single edits. For reference, the drifted values currently live in production as follows.

deployment values, kajep-kageg:
[praix]
host = praix.paliqcorp.corp
user = praix_svc
database = praix_prod

Finance review: warranty-cost overrun on the Stellix pump series. Claims ran 42% above forecast in the last two quarters, driven by a seal defect in units built at the Dunmere plant. Total exposure now exceeds the annual reserve. Supplier remediation is underway; redesigned seals ship next month. We propose doubling the reserve and booking a one-time charge this quarter. Board approval requested. A confidential note on related plans appears below.

management briefing: Only 5 of the 80 pilot accounts renewed Zorix, so a churn review is set for October 1.